Build a Strong Online Presence
In today’s digital age, having a strong online presence is essential for job seekers. A robust LinkedIn profile, personal website, or online portfolio can showcase your skills, experience, and accomplishments. It can also make it easier for recruiters and hiring managers to find and evaluate your qualifications.
Network
Networking is a crucial aspect of job searching, and it can help you stand out in a crowded job market. Attend industry events, connect with professionals in your field, and join professional organizations to expand your network. Networking can help you learn about job opportunities, gain insider knowledge about companies, and build relationships with people who can advocate for you.
Gain Relevant Experience
Gaining relevant experience in your desired field is another way to stand out in a competitive job market. Consider internships, part-time jobs, or volunteer work to gain relevant experience and develop your skills. This can demonstrate to employers that you’re passionate about your chosen field and are committed to developing your career.
Hone Your Skills
Honing your skills is essential for standing out in a competitive job market. Consider taking courses, attending conferences, or participating in workshops to develop your skills and stay up-to-date with industry trends. This can help you stay competitive and showcase your knowledge and expertise to potential employers.
Demonstrate Passion and Enthusiasm
Finally, demonstrating passion and enthusiasm for the job can help you stand out in a crowded job market. Research the company and the role thoroughly, and be prepared to articulate why you’re excited about the opportunity. Be engaged and enthusiastic during the interview process, and show that you’re willing to go above and beyond to contribute to the company’s success.
